Frequently Asked Questions

What are the essential components of a top-tier tactical gear kit?

A '10/10' tactical kit should include a minimum of three magazines, a tourniquet (TQ), an Individual First Aid Kit (IFAK), a helmet, a primary weapon system, and reliable communication equipment like a radio and PTT setup.

What common mistakes should be avoided when setting up a plate carrier?

Avoid double-stacking magazines on the front of your plate carrier, as this can significantly hinder your ability to shoot effectively from a prone position. Also, ensure all pouches and accessories have robust stitching to prevent failure.

How can you differentiate between a practical tactical kit and a purely aesthetic one?

Focus on functionality and purpose. Practical kits prioritize essential life-saving gear (TQ, IFAK), reliable weapon systems, and effective communication. Aesthetic kits might look good but lack crucial operational elements or use low-quality components.

What brands are mentioned in the context of high-quality tactical gear?

The video mentions brands like Crye Precision, Ferro Concepts, Spiritus Systems, and Harris radios, often associated with professional-grade equipment used in military and law enforcement applications.
